About Kyllinga bulbosa

Kyllinga bulbosa (Kyllinga bulbosa) is a herb belonging to the Cyperaceae family (Sedge family). Members of this family are generally characterised by 3-ranked narrow linear leaves, spikelet clusters flower clusters, achene fruit. It is typically found in marshy areas. It occurs across Paleotropics. Flowering and fruiting are typically seen during August-December. Its conservation status has been assessed as Least Concern (LC).
